Buffett … U.S. Economy in Shambles
Warren Buffett
During an interview on CNBC Berkshire Hathaway’s chairman and chief executive Warren Buffett said that the U.S. economy is in shambles. Buffett also said he’s sure the actions the government has taken in the past year to help the economy will result in high inflation down the road. Buffett also said that even with all the unprecedented Government spending he saw no bounce in the economy.

It’s never paid to bet against America
Warren Buffett was interviewed on Dateline NBC last night and described the current state of the economy as an "economic Pearl Harbor" that is not as bad as the Great Depression or World War II, but still is very significant. The Oracle of Omaha said that fear is permeating the American psyche, "which leads to people not wanting to spend and not wanting to make investments, and that leads to more fear. We'll break out of it. It takes time." Buffett didn't wish to guess when the crisis would end, but he did leave with one piece of powerful advice: "It's never paid to bet against America…We come through things, but it's not always a smooth ride."
